Migliaccio & Rathod LLP is involved in the LexisNexis Risk Solutions Data Breach Investigation, regarding a breach that impacted 364,333 individuals and their personal information.
On or about April 1, 2025, LexisNexis Risk Solutions discovered unusual activity within its computer network. LexisNexis Risk Solutions subsequently conducted an investigation, which determined a cybercriminal had stolen the personally identifiable information of individuals maintained therein on or around December 25, 2024. The compromised information may include the following sensitive data:
- full names
- Social Security numbers
- dates of birth
- addresses
- contact information
- driver’s license numbers
